Malta and Jersey sign double taxation agreement

Jan 28th, 2010 | By maltainc | Category: Malta's competitive advantage, Taxation, Trade Finance

Malta and Jersey have signed a double taxation avoidance agreement.
The agreement was signed by Maltese High Commissioner Joseph Zammit Tabona and Chief Minister Terry Le Sueur. The signing ceremony took place at the Malta High Commission, London.  Mr Zammit Tabona said the agreement was instrumental for trade relations to be strengthened further. Malta-Belgium double taxation agreement amended

Jan 21st, 2010 | By maltainc | Category: Economics, Services to facilitate business, Taxation, Trade Finance

Maltese Finance Minister Tonio Fenech and his Belgian counterpart, Didier Reynders, have signed an agreement to amend the existing double taxation agreement between the 2 countries.  The amendment seeks to bring the agreement’s provisions on the exchange of information in line with internationally agreed standards. The original agreement was reached in 1974, and was amended in 1993.
